Effect of Mwnts on Photocatalytic Activity of ZnS Nanocrystals

Ghanshyam Tripathi, Balram Tripathi, M. K. Sharma and Y. K. Vijay


ZnS nanocrystals have been decorated with multiwall carbon nanotubes (MWNTs) by chemical route. Optical absorption studies have been performed by using dye (methylene blue) as a probe on ZnS nanocrystals and ZnS/MWNTs composites. Methylene blue degradation on ZnS/MWNTs composites revealed that carbon nanotubes could effectively increase the photocatalytic activity of ZnS nanocrystals as well as rate of electron induced redox reaction. CNT decorated photocatalysts can be utilized for ultrafast nonlinear optical switching, super capacitance and improved optical luminescence.
